About the role

This position sits within the Justice Response cluster and supports the Victims Assistance Program (VAP) offers specialist responses to victims of crime, including intake and brief intervention, case management, (brokered) counselling services, and community education. Practice is evidence and trauma-informed and client-focussed. VAP staff work across locations in Melbourne’s west, with successful co-locations with police in three areas and an intake hub in Maribyrnong. Clients are from the whole of the Western Region.

This role was developed in response to the significant growth in VAP agencies assisting family violence victims as demand for services increased and referrals from specialist family violence services continued to grow. The roles were also created in recognition of the importance of having family violence specialists within VAP services to provide best practice support for victims of family violence, as well as enabling secondary consultation for non-specialist family violence workers within VAPs to further support their work with victims
